Nigeria, IRENA Launches Nigeria''s Renewable Energy Roadmap
The Nigerian government and the International Renewable Energy Agency (IRENA) have launched the Renewable Energy Roadmap (Remap) Nigeria to meet Nigeria''s energy demands following the projections to meet nearly 60 per cent of Nigeria''s energy demand in 2050 with renewable energy sources.

Does Nigeria have a high solar resource potential?
Nigeria has high solar resource potential characterised by an average annual global horizontal irradiation ranging between 1 600 kilowatt hours per square metre (kWh/m2) and 2 200 kWh/m2 with the highest values (greater than 2 000 kWh/m2) located in the northern part of the country.
Why is Nigeria importing 80% of its oil products from abroad?
While Nigeria is trying to get its refineries working at optimum capacity, the existing capacity is insuficient to satisfy the local demand for petroleum products. To meet this requirement, 80% of the refined oil products used in Nigeria are imported from abroad (PWC, 2017).
Does Nigeria have a coal power plant?
The Nigerian Energy Masterplan and Vision 30-30-30 seek to integrate coal into the Nigerian electricity supply mix. However, there is currently no existing coal power plant in the country.
